Plant Species Composition Of Main Green Space And Their Relationship With Artificial Environment In The Built-up Area Of Chongqing Main Area

With the rapid urbanization in China in recent years,the pattern of land using in the rapidly expanding urban areas has changed drastically,resulting in great changes in the urban ecological environment.A large number of studies at home and abroad show that urbanization is an important cause of extinction of native species,invasion of alien species,and homogenization of plants,which leads to urban biodiversity face many severe challenges.Urban plants are the key elements of the urban environment and have important social and ecological service functions for humans and wildlife in cities.However,urban plant communities are complex social-environmental systems whose species composition,diversity,and influencing factors is affected by social factors and environmental factors have a common influence on time and space,which means that the urban environment has strong environmental filtering effect on urban plant communities.Therefore,studying the composition and distribution of urban plant species is of great significance in exploring changes of flora under the influence of human activities and the protection for urban plant diversity,which can improve urban sustainability and protect wildlife for urban managers.The study provides a scientific basis to promote the construction of eco-livable cities and achieve the sustainable development goal of harmonious coexistence between man and nature.This paper based on Stratified Random Survey investigating the four main types of green space in roads,parks,residential areas,and units in the main urban built-up area of Chongqing main area in order to analysis plant species composition and their relationship with the artificial environment,and provide scientific and reliable data references to urban green spaces construction and management optimization and urban biodiversity protection.The main conclusions reached are as follows:(1)Green space plant species compositionA total of 550 plant species including varieties belonging to 376 genera and 135 families were concerned.In family and genus composition,there are 123 species of trees belonging to 85 genera and 50 families,110 species of shrubs belonging to 77 genera and 42 families,298 species of herbs belonging to 213 genera and 74 families,and 19 species of vines belonging to 16 genera and 11 families.The five families with the most plant species are Compositae,Gramineae,Rosaceae,Leguminosae,and Cyperaceae,and the three genera with the most plant species are Ficus,Ligustrum,and Pilea.There are 49 families and 266 genera in a single species.The most abundant families and genera were recorded in park green spaces and residential green spaces,while relatively fewer inroad green spaces.In plant sources composition,native plants and alien plants accounted for 58% and 42% of the total plant species,the proportion of alien plants is large and 81% of the alien plants were introduced ornamental plant which means that the proportion of alien plants is closely related to their ornamental value;domestic alien plants accounted for 49% of total alien plants,mainly from East China Coastal and South China;foreign alien plants of account for 51% of total alien plants,mainly from Asia and the Americas.The four types of green space are mainly dominated by native plants.Except for the relatively small number of native plants in road green space,the distribution of plants from various sources is not much different.In life form composition,the plant life form is divided into evergreen trees,deciduous trees,evergreen shrubs,deciduous shrubs,perennial herbs,annual herbs,grassy vines,and woody vines,and the ratio is about 11: 7: 13: 2: 23 : 21: 2: 1.The life forms are mainly herbaceous plants,with a total of 298 species,accounting for 55.1% of the total number of plants;in trees and shrubs,the evergreen plants are dominating plants,with a total of 166 species,accounting for 71.6% of the total number of trees and shrubs.Among the plant life forms of different sources,the native plant life forms are dominated by perennial herbs and annual herbs,accounting for 33.8% and 27.7% of the total number of native plants.The domestic alien plant life forms are dominated by evergreen trees and perennial herbs account for 23.6% of the total number of domestic alien plants;the life forms of foreign plants are mainly evergreen shrubs and annual herbs,which account for 23.5% and 29.4% of the total number of foreign alien plants.The plant life forms of four types of green space are mainly herbaceous plants,and the herbaceous plants are dominated by perennial herbs.The plant life forms of the four types of green space are relatively evenly distributed except for the evergreen trees in the road green space.In flora,the flora involves 14 geographic area types and 13 geographic area variants.Native plants are mainly composed of Pantropic and North Temperate;domestic alien plants are mainly composed of Pantropic and Trop.Asia(Indo-Malesia);the foreign alien plants are mainly composed of Trop.Asia and Trop.Amer.disjuncted.In general,flora components are predominantly Pantropic.In dominant species,the top three importance value of trees is Ficus microcarpa,Ficus virens,Cinnamomum camphora;the top three importance values of shrubs are Loropetalum chinense var.rubrum,Ligustrum × vicaryi,Ligustrum sinense;the top three importance value of herbs is Zoysia pacifica,Ophiopogon japonicus,Digitaria sanguinalis.The dominant species of trees and shrubs are artificially cultivated plants,while the dominant species of herbaceous plants are mostly spontaneous plants.The top ten importance value of trees,shrubs,and herbs in the four types of green spaces are highly similar.Herbs have the absolute advantage of Zoysia pacifica and Ophiopogon japonicus.In addition,the vast majority of other plants are spontaneous plants.In species diversity index,the Simpson index,Shannon-Wiener index,Pilou evenness index,and Patrick's index of the four types of green space as follow,the green space in the residential area is 0.92,3.49,0.59,355,the green space in the park is 0.56,1.92,0.33,358,the road green space is 0.71,2.39,0.43,270,and the unit green space is 0.70,2.41,0.41,346.In general,the species diversity index has the highest green space in the residential area and the lowest green space in the park.The road green space and the unit green space are in the middle and there is not much difference between the two.In the composition of invasive species,there are 26 invasive plants in the four main green spaces,and the life form is mainly herbaceous plants,accounting for 58% of the total number of invasive plant species.Among the herbaceous plants,annual herbs are the main species,accounting for 80% of the invasive herbaceous plants.Therefore,the control of invasive species should focus on herbaceous plants.(2)Association classification and its characteristicsAccording to the characteristics of the species composition of urban plants,divided into herbs,and trees and shrubs for TWINSPAN classification separately.The classification results divided the 393 trees and shrubs plot into 47 groups,13 groups were more than 2% of total plots,which have 249 plots,accounting for 63.4% of the total plots;1181 herb plots were divided into 60 groups,14 groups were larger than 2% of the total plots,with a total of 781 plots,accounting for the total plot 66.1% of the amount.The classification results are analyzed from four aspects including sample plot(square)quantity,indicator species,distribution in various types of green space,and species diversity index,which can provide references for urban green space plant selection and management and maintenance optimization.(3)Relationship between plant species composition of green space and artificial environmentThe species structure of green space plants is mainly influenced by the artificial environment conditions created through four types of pathways: green plants design,management,human interference,and lighting conditions.For the design of green space plants,on the one hand,selectively retains and transforms natural green space during urban construction,on the other hand,artificial green space selects and configures plant species during design and construction,thereby determining the initial composition of urban green space plants.For management,that is,artificially shaping,pruning,weeding,pest control,plant replacement,etc.of plants in the built green space,mainly affects the growth of plant species to affect the composition of plant species.For human interference mainly refers to the interference that occurs when people use the green space in their daily life,such as trampling,soil consolidation,and garbage dumping.On the one hand,through human activities,consciously or unconsciously helped the spread of certain plants in green spaces.For lighting conditions,on the one hand,the introduction to tropical plants that like light and heat change the proportion of foreign plants,on the other hand,the trees used for shading to make the trees densely opaque,making it difficult for shrubs and herbs to grow.
